What Is a Parcel Audit?
A parcel audit is a systematic review of shipping invoices to identify billing errors, service failures, and incorrect charges from carriers like UPS and FedEx. Parcel auditing compares the amount charged against the amount that should have been charged based on the carrier contract, published rates, and service guarantees.
Carriers process millions of packages daily, and mistakes happen. Shippers may be charged for a service level that was never received, billed for incorrect package dimensions, or assessed duplicate surcharges. Service guarantee violations, when carriers fail to deliver packages on time per their commitments, also entitle shippers to refunds, but these credits do not appear automatically on invoices.
Modern parcel audit services use automated technology to analyze shipping invoices in real time. These platforms continuously monitor every charge, flag discrepancies immediately, and file claims on the shipper’s behalf. What was once a tedious manual task becomes an automated recovery engine that works around the clock.

Why Are Parcel Audit Services So Important?
Parcel audit services deliver value that extends far beyond simple cost recovery. Here’s why they’ve become essential for businesses serious about managing their shipping operations effectively.
Cost Recovery and Budget Protection
The most immediate benefit is financial. Parcel audit services identify and recover money that already belongs to the shipper: refunds for service failures, corrections for billing errors, and credits for incorrect surcharges. For high-volume shippers, these recoveries can total thousands, or even tens of thousands, of dollars per month. Without auditing, this money simply disappears into shipping expenses.
Operational Efficiency
Reviewing invoices manually wastes valuable time that shipping teams could spend on strategic initiatives. Automated parcel audit services eliminate this burden, freeing teams to focus on optimizing carrier selection, improving packaging, or enhancing customer delivery experiences rather than hunting for billing errors.
Stronger Carrier Contract Strategy
Parcel audit data reveals patterns in carrier performance and billing practices. A data-driven carrier contract strategy, built on concrete evidence of service failures, recurring billing errors, and excessive surcharges, gives shippers a stronger position when engaging carriers.
Increased Shipping Visibility
Comprehensive auditing provides transparency into true shipping costs. Shippers gain clarity not just on what they are paying, but why. This visibility helps identify cost drivers, evaluate carrier performance objectively, and support data-informed decisions about shipping strategy.
Carrier Accountability
When carriers know their invoices are being audited thoroughly, billing accuracy tends to improve. Regular auditing and claim filing create accountability, encouraging carriers to maintain higher standards in their billing practices and service delivery.
6 Essential Features To Look For in a Parcel Audit Service
Not all parcel audit services offer the same capabilities or deliver the same results. When evaluating solutions, prioritize these six essential features that separate effective audit platforms from basic invoice review tools.
1. Real-Time Carrier Integration
The foundation of effective parcel auditing is seamless data connectivity with carriers. Shippers should prioritize services that integrate directly with UPS, FedEx, and other carriers to automatically ingest invoice data as it is generated, not days or weeks later.
Real-time integration ensures the audit platform captures every shipment and charge immediately, enabling faster identification of discrepancies and quicker claim filing. Delayed data means delayed recovery, and in some cases, claim-filing windows can be missed entirely. The strongest audit services pull data automatically, eliminating manual file uploads or exports while reducing data gaps and human error.
2. Automated Invoice Verification
Manual spot-checking cannot match the thoroughness of automated invoice verification. A parcel audit service should automatically examine every line item on every invoice, comparing charges against contracted rates and service commitments.
Automated verification catches discrepancies that humans typically miss, including subtle weight rounding errors, incorrectly applied surcharges, and residential delivery fees charged for commercial addresses. The platform should run continuously in the background, analyzing invoices 24/7 without requiring any action from the shipping team.
3. Comprehensive Credit Type Identification
A truly effective parcel audit service does not just look for one or two types of errors. It identifies the full spectrum of recoverable credits. A strong audit platform should detect:
- Overcharges billed above contracted rates
- Duplicate charges for the same shipment or service
- Weight and dimension discrepancies from incorrect measurements
- Service guarantee violations when carriers miss delivery commitments
- Incorrectly applied surcharges, such as residential fees or address corrections
- Rating errors and misclassified service levels
Credit types matter significantly. Some audit services focus narrowly on service guarantee refunds while missing other categories that represent substantial recovery opportunities. Shippers should choose a solution that casts the widest possible net.
4. Automated Dispute Filing and Cost Recovery
Identifying billing errors is only half the work. Recovery requires a service that actually reclaims the money on the shipper’s behalf. The best parcel audit platforms automatically file disputes with carriers and manage the entire recovery process from start to finish.
Shippers should look for:
- Automatic claim generation and submission through carrier channels
- Real-time tracking of claim status from submission to resolution
- Visibility into recovery rates, approved amounts, and credited funds
An effective audit service handles all of this seamlessly, delivering real financial results without requiring intervention from the shipping team.
5. Claim Management Support
Beyond automation, comprehensive claim management support ensures nothing falls through the cracks. Carriers sometimes push back on legitimate claims or request additional documentation, so an audit partner needs the expertise to respond effectively. The right service handles the follow-up rather than leaving shippers to chase carriers or navigate complex dispute procedures, acting as the shipper’s advocate.
6. Real-Time Reporting and Analytics
Raw audit data has limited value without the ability to extract meaningful insights. A parcel audit service should provide comprehensive, real-time reporting with customizable dashboards and data visualizations that surface what matters most.
Essential reporting capabilities include:
- Customizable dashboards tailored to business priorities
- Pattern identification in billing errors across carriers and service levels
- Trend analysis over time to spot recurring issues
- Drill-down capabilities into specific shipment types or cost categories
- Total credits recovered with detailed breakdowns
Effective reporting goes beyond showing total credits recovered. It reveals which carriers generate the most discrepancies, informs data-driven decisions about carrier selection and contract strategy, and identifies operational improvement opportunities.

What is the difference between a parcel audit and a freight audit?
A parcel audit reviews small-package carrier invoices from UPS, FedEx, and similar carriers, focusing on errors like late-delivery refunds, surcharge accuracy, and dimensional weight. A freight audit covers LTL and full-truckload billing across all modes. Many shippers need both, since parcel and freight billing follow different rules and error patterns.
